DeGarmo & Key Band - Straight On

It's Valentine's Day, who loves you baby? Jesus Loves you. Since my first VD post was probably a little suspect, let's try and wash things clean with a little classic Christian rock. I'd always wanted to get the first couple of DeGarmo & Key albums, but never did. I did pick up their double live album No Turning Back in '82 that contained a decent selection of songs from their first three records, so it sort of scratched that itch. I am getting ahead of myself though. The first record of theirs I got was their third release This Ain't Hollywood , and at the time I found myself mostly ambivalent to many of the songs on the album. There were a couple I really liked, but mostly I listened to it because I wanted to like it, and frankly I didn't have so many records that I had a lot of choice.
